基于USB2.0的多串口数据采集设计
DOI:
作者:
作者单位:

1. 榆林学院能源工程学院测控教研室 榆林 719000; 2. 中国人民解放军96658部队 北京 100094; 3. 西北机电工程研究所第九研究室 咸阳 712000

作者简介:

通讯作者:

中图分类号:

TB47

基金项目:


Designing the multi serial ports data collection based on USB2.0
Author:
Affiliation:

1. The office of Measurement and Control in Energy Engineering Institute of Yulin University, Yulin 719000, China; 2. PLA 96658 Unit, Beijing 100094, China; 3. Northwest Institute of Mechanical & Electrical Engineering, Xianyang 712000, China

Fund Project:

  • 摘要
  • |
  • 图/表
  • |
  • 访问统计
  • |
  • 参考文献
  • |
  • 相似文献
  • |
  • 引证文献
  • |
  • 资源附件
  • |
  • 文章评论
    摘要:

    针对多串口实际需求,依据USB2.0与串口传输速度差特点,提出了一种基于USB2.0的多通道串口数据采集方案。在硬件上,针对热插热拔设备供电限制及系统可靠性要求,对主要芯片进行论证选型,并设计系统框架;在软件上,为了避免多串口主动同时“抢占”USB接口而导致数据丢帧问题,引入多级缓存结构,变主动“抢占”为被动入栈,同时采用统计方法设计串口防抖捕获模型。为了验证设计模型的有效性,以Demo平台为试验对象,设计了4路串口传输的试验方案,实验结果满足预期要求,达到多路串口传输的目的。

    Abstract:

    For the actual demand of multiserial port, a USB2.0  based multichannel serial data acquisition scheme was proposed in this paper according to the characteristics of USB2.0 and serial transmission speed difference. In the respect of hardware, for the hot stuck equipment power supply restrictions and system reliability requirements, the main chip demonstration selection, and the system framework was designed; In the respect of software, in order to avoid multiserial active at the same time ‘preemptive’ USB interface and data frames loss, the multilevel cache structure was introduced to change the initiative to ‘preemptive’ for the passive stack. At the same time, the serial image stabilization capture model was designed by statistical method. In order to verify the effectiveness of the design model, the test scheme of 4way serial transmission was designed with the Demo platform as the test object. The test results meet the expected requirements and achieve the purpose of multichannel serial transmission.

    参考文献
    相似文献
    引证文献
引用本文

郭敏,庄信武,任海波,王向东.基于USB2.0的多串口数据采集设计[J].国外电子测量技术,2017,36(11):75-79

复制
分享
文章指标
  • 点击次数:
  • 下载次数:
  • HTML阅读次数:
  • 引用次数:
历史
  • 收稿日期:
  • 最后修改日期:
  • 录用日期:
  • 在线发布日期: 2017-12-23
  • 出版日期: